What Are Robot Hoover and Mop Systems?
Robot hoover and mop systems are autonomous cleaning devices developed to maintain the cleanliness of floors in homes and offices. These robots are geared up with innovative sensing units, mapping innovation, and AI algorithms that allow them to navigate through spaces, identify dirt and obstacles, and clean efficiently without human intervention. The hoover part is responsible for vacuuming dust, dirt, and particles, while the mop component is entrusted with wet cleaning and polishing difficult surface areas.
Key Features and Functions
Autonomous Navigation
Mapping and Planning: Modern robot hoover and mop systems use LiDAR (Light Detection and Ranging) or visual navigation systems to develop a map of the environment. This enables them to plan effective cleaning routes and prevent challenges.Smart Obstacle Detection: Advanced sensors assist the robot discover and browse around furniture, animals, and other challenges, ensuring that it doesn’t get stuck or trigger damage.
Multi-Surface Cleaning
Flexibility: These robots can clean up a range of surface areas, including hardwood, tile, and carpet. Some designs are even developed to shift effortlessly between various kinds of floor covering.Adjustable Water Flow: For the mopping function, adjustable water flow settings ensure that the correct amount of wetness is utilized on different surfaces to prevent water damage.
Personalized Cleaning Schedules
Timed Cleaning: Users can set specific times for the robot to start cleaning, enabling a consistent and foreseeable cleaning schedule.Remote Control: Most robotics can be controlled via a mobile phone app, making it possible for users to start, stop, or schedule cleaning sessions from anywhere.
Effective Dirt and Dust Removal
Premium Filters: Many designs include HEPA filters that capture great dust and allergens, making them ideal for homes with allergies.Strong Suction: Powerful motors provide strong suction to raise and get rid of embedded dirt and particles from floors.
Maintenance and Convenience
Self-Emptying Bins: Some sophisticated designs include self-emptying bins, lowering the need for regular manual upkeep.Auto-Return to Charging Station: When the battery is low, the robot instantly returns to its charging station, guaranteeing it is constantly all set for the next cleaning session.
Integration with Smart Home Devices
Voice Control: Compatibility with smart home assistants like Amazon Alexa and Google Assistant enables for voice-activated cleaning.Home Security: Some models can be equipped with video cameras and motion sensing units, doubling as security gadgets while they clean up.Benefits of Robot Hoover and Mop Systems

Q: How often should I clean my robot hoover and mop?
A: It’s advised to clean the brushes, filters, and mopping cloths after every 3-5 cleaning sessions to ensure optimal efficiency.
Q: Can these robotics tidy stairs?
A: No, a lot of robot hoover and mop systems are created to tidy flat surfaces and can not browse stairs.
Q: Are they appropriate for homes with animals?
A: Yes, numerous designs are geared up with pet hair cleaning features and can handle the additional dirt and hair that pets bring into the home.
Q: How long do the batteries last?
A: Battery life varies by model, however most robots can clean up for 90-120 minutes before requiring a recharge.
Q: Can I manage the robot with my voice?
A: Yes, many models work with smart home assistants like Amazon Alexa and Google Assistant, enabling voice-activated control.
